Shelly Anderson Photography | Blog »

Laurel and Dave’s Sunset Cliffs Wedding

LaurelDaveWeddingBlog-22

Laurel and Dave quietly got hitched in front of just immediate family members on the bluffs of Sunset Cliffs in Ocean Beach. Dave waited patiently for Laurel to arrive, where they did a first look overlooking Osprey Point. Family members arrived shortly after, and we picked out “the spot” where they would say “I do”. It was sweet and intimate. Everyone stood around them as they exchanged vows and kissed for the first time as husband and wife. That evening after the sun set, they all celebrated with a wedding day dinner. Congrats to you both!!

 

LaurelDaveWeddingBlog-2LaurelDaveWeddingBlog-4LaurelDaveWeddingBlog-6LaurelDaveWeddingBlog-5LaurelDaveWeddingBlog-8LaurelDaveWeddingBlog-9LaurelDaveWeddingBlog-10LaurelDaveWeddingBlog-11LaurelDaveWeddingBlog-12LaurelDaveWeddingBlog-14LaurelDaveWeddingBlog-15LaurelDaveWeddingBlog-17LaurelDaveWeddingBlog-19LaurelDaveWeddingBlog-20LaurelDaveWeddingBlog-21LaurelDaveWeddingBlog-22LaurelDaveWeddingBlog-24LaurelDaveWeddingBlog-26LaurelDaveWeddingBlog-27LaurelDaveWeddingBlog-28LaurelDaveWeddingBlog-29LaurelDaveWeddingBlog-32LaurelDaveWeddingBlog-33LaurelDaveWeddingBlog-34LaurelDaveWeddingBlog-39LaurelDaveWeddingBlog-30LaurelDaveWeddingBlog-36LaurelDaveWeddingBlog-41LaurelDaveWeddingBlog-42LaurelDaveWeddingBlog-43LaurelDaveWeddingBlog-45LaurelDaveWeddingBlog-46LaurelDaveWeddingBlog-47LaurelDaveWeddingBlog-48LaurelDaveWeddingBlog-49LaurelDaveWeddingBlog-51LaurelDaveWeddingBlog-52LaurelDaveWeddingBlog-54LaurelDaveWeddingBlog-53LaurelDaveWeddingBlog-55LaurelDaveWeddingBlog-56LaurelDaveWeddingBlog-57LaurelDaveWeddingBlog-58LaurelDaveWeddingBlog-59LaurelDaveWeddingBlog-62LaurelDaveWeddingBlog-63LaurelDaveWeddingBlog-65LaurelDaveWeddingBlog-66LaurelDaveWeddingBlog-67LaurelDaveWeddingBlog-68LaurelDaveWeddingBlog-69LaurelDaveWeddingBlog-71LaurelDaveWeddingBlog-72LaurelDaveWeddingBlog-74LaurelDaveWeddingBlog-75LaurelDaveWeddingBlog-76LaurelDaveWeddingBlog-79LaurelDaveWeddingBlog-77LaurelDaveWeddingBlog-78LaurelDaveWeddingBlog-80LaurelDaveWeddingBlog-82LaurelDaveWeddingBlog-83LaurelDaveWeddingBlog-84LaurelDaveWeddingBlog-85LaurelDaveWeddingBlog-86LaurelDaveWeddingBlog-87LaurelDaveWeddingBlog-89LaurelDaveWeddingBlog-90LaurelDaveWeddingBlog-92LaurelDaveWeddingBlog-94LaurelDaveWeddingBlog-96LaurelDaveWeddingBlog-100LaurelDaveWeddingBlog-103LaurelDaveWeddingBlog-104LaurelDaveWeddingBlog-107LaurelDaveWeddingBlog-108LaurelDaveWeddingBlog-110LaurelDaveWeddingBlog-111LaurelDaveWeddingBlog-113LaurelDaveWeddingBlog-114LaurelDaveWeddingBlog-116LaurelDaveWeddingBlog-117LaurelDaveWeddingBlog-118LaurelDaveWeddingBlog-119LaurelDaveWeddingBlog-124LaurelDaveWeddingBlog-120LaurelDaveWeddingBlog-126

sharetweetpinemail

Your email is never published or shared. Required fields are marked *

*

*